Goldberry, the idea for the Walk to Rivendell originally came from the Éowyn Challenge site, so please click on that link for explanations. The whole idea is just to encourage walking or other exercise in a Middle-earth context. We start from Bag End in Hobbiton, and Rivendell is the goal, though some of us who have already reached that are walking on to Lothlórien. On the Éowyn Challenge site, you can record your miles on the Milestones Celebration page. Be sure to register that you are walking for the Barrow-Downs!
